Transaction acdb7b11018ac838ad605f46097df8f5afe3f45f486d21155c53c7a8ce81a666
1 Input
1 Output
-
acdb7b11018ac838ad605f46097df8f5afe3f45f486d21155c53c7a8ce81a666:0
- value
- 334515
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5389e4a25646e832d093ec55d12690b240d9672
- address
- bc1q65ufuj39v3hgxtgf8mz46ynfpvjqm9njnmjyyf